Sixmile Creek
Sixmile Creek is a stream in Stevens, Washington and has an elevation of 2,710 feet. Sixmile Creek is situated nearby to the hamlet Bingville, as well as near Cozy Nook.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Chewelah is a city in Stevens County, Washington, United States. It is located approximately 45 mi northwest of Spokane. The population was 2,470 at the 2020 census. Chewelah is situated 6 miles southwest of Sixmile Creek.
